Ingredients

  • Rice Bowl:

    • 1 cup of basmati rice
    • 2 cups of water
    • 1 tablespoon olive oil
    • 1 teaspoon salt
    • Zest and juice of 1 large lemon
    • 1/2 cup chopped fresh herbs (such as parsley, cilantro, and mint)
    • 1/4 cup toasted pine nuts
    • 1/2 cup cooked chickpeas
    • 1 small cucumber, diced
  • Dressing:

    • 1/4 cup olive oil
    •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
    • 1 garlic clove, minced
    • Salt and pepper to taste

Cooking Method

Step 1: Prepare the Rice

  1. Rinse the basmati rice under cold water until the water runs clear.
  2. In a medium saucepan, combine the rice, water, olive oil, and salt. Bring to a boil.
  3. Once boiling, reduce the he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es or until the rice is cooked and the water is absorbed.
  4. Remove from heat and let it sit covered for 5 minutes, then fluff with a fork.

Step 2: Mix in the Flavors

  1. In a large bowl, combine the cooked rice, lemon zest, lemon juice, chopped herbs, toasted pine nuts, chickpeas, and diced cucumber.
  2. Toss gently to combine all ingredients evenly.

Step 3: Prepare the Dressing

  1.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, salt, and pepper.
  2. Pour the dressing over the rice mixture and toss well to coat.

Step 4: Serve

  1. Divide the rice mixture into serving bowls.
  2. Serve warm or at room temperature, garnished with extra herbs or a sprinkle of lemon zest if desired.

Nutritional Value and Pairings

The Zesty Lemon Herb Rice Bowl is not only a delight for the taste buds but also a nutritional powerhouse. Packed with complex carbohydrates from the rice, healthy fats from olive oil and pine nuts, and protein from chickpeas, this dish offers a balanced meal that supports energy and satiety. The fresh herbs and lemon provide a boost of vitamins and antioxidants, enhancing your overall well-being.

For the best pairing options, consider serving this dish with a crisp green salad, such as an arugula and spinach blend with a light vinaigrette. As for drinks, a chilled glass of white wine like Sauvignon Blanc or a refreshing iced mint tea would complement the zesty flavors beautifully.
